Which Countries Produce the Most Tomatoes?

Tomatoes are one of the most popular foods on Earth. Even though a lot of people intrinsically associate tomatoes with vegetables because of how they taste, tomatoes are actually a fruit because they have seeds. Tomatoes are used in everything from ketchup to pasta sauce and from salads to food garnishes. Therefore, there is a tremendous amount of demand for tomatoes, and there are some countries that produce more tomatoes than others.

For example, China produces more tomatoes than any other country on Earth. In 2017, China produced approximately 60 million tons of tomatoes in a single year. This is more than twice the number of tomatoes produced by the second country, India. India produced approximately 20 million tons of tomatoes in 2017.

Does the United States Produce a Lot of Tomatoes?

Yes, the United States produces a lot of tomatoes as well. The United States is the fifth largest producer of tomatoes on the planet. Unfortunately, the number of tomatoes produced by the United States is gradually dropping. In 2016, the United States produced close to 13 million tons of tomatoes. Then, in 2017, the United States produced approximately 10 million tons of tomatoes.

Does Europe Produce a Lot of Tomatoes?

There are some countries in Europe that produce tomatoes as well, but tomatoes tend to thrive in warmer climates. Therefore, countries located in Europe may have a difficult time producing a lot of tomatoes. Italy is responsible for producing more tomatoes than any other European country. Because Italy extends closer to the equator than other countries in Europe, it should come as no surprise that it produces a lot of tomatoes. Italy produces approximately six million tons of tomatoes every year. Because Italy is known for its pasta, it should come as no surprise that Italy is also great at producing tomatoes.
